London City Authorities Cancel Ola's Operating Licence
Citing that its app was not "fit and proper", authorities of London city have cancelled the operating licence of Ola. Transport for London (TfL) said that Ola did not adhere to the public safety regulations. Reportedly, TfL found Ola drivers without licence undertaking over 1000 passenger trips. However, it added that Ola can appeal against the decision in 21 days. The Bengaluru-based Ola began operations in London from February 2020.
